VSAM data sets
You create a VSAM data set by running the Access Methods Services (AMS) utility program IDCAMS in a batch job, or by using the TSO DEFINE command in a TSO session. The DEFINE command specifies to VSAM and z/OS® the VSAM attributes and characteristics of your data set. You can also use it to identify the catalog in which your data set is to be defined.
If required, you can load the data set with data, again using IDCAMS. You use the AMS REPRO command to copy data from an existing data set into the newly created one.
You can also load an empty VSAM data set from a CICS® transaction. You do this by defining the data set to CICS (by allocating the data set to a CICS file), and then writing data to the data set, regardless of its empty state. See Loading empty VSAM data sets.
When you create a data set, you can define a data set name of up to 44 characters. If you choose not to define a name, VSAM assigns the name for you. This name, known as the data set name (or DSNAME), uniquely identifies the data set to your z/OS system.
You can define VSAM data sets accessed by user files under CICS file control as eligible to be backed up while CICS is currently updating these data sets. For more information about backing up VSAM files open for update, see Defining backup while open (BWO) for VSAM files.
VSAM bases and paths
You store data in data sets, and retrieve data from data sets, using application programs that reference the data at the record level.
Depending on the type of data set, you can identify a record for retrieval by its key (a unique value in a predefined field in the record), by its relative byte address, or by its relative record number.
Access to records through these methods of primary identification is known as access through the base.
Sometimes you may need to identify and access your records by a secondary or alternate key. With VSAM, you can build one or more alternate indexes over a single base data set, so that you do not need to keep multiple copies of the same information organized in different ways for different applications. Using this method, you create an alternate index path (or paths), that links the alternate index (or indexes) with the base. You can then use the alternate key to access the records by specifying the path as the data set to be accessed, that is by allocating the path data set to a CICS file.
When you create a path you give it a name of up to 44 characters, in the same way as a base data set. A CICS application program does not need to know whether it is accessing your data through a path or a base; except that it may be necessary to allow for duplicate keys if the alternate index was specified to have non-unique keys.
Reuse of data sets
If you define a data set with the AMS REUSE attribute, it can also be emptied of data during a CICS run. This allows it to be used as a work file. When the status of a file referencing the data set is CLOSED and DISABLED (or UNENABLED), you can use the SET EMPTY command, either from an application program using the EXEC CICS command-level interface, or from a main terminal using the main terminal CEMT command. This command sets an indicator in the installed file definition so that when the file is next opened, the VSAM high-used relative byte address (RBA) is set to zero, and the contents of the data set are effectively cleared.
